Day 1 – The Icons of the Old City at a Gentle Pace
Morning: Sultanahmet – Hagia Sophia, Blue Mosque & the Ancient Hippodrome
Your guide meets you at your hotel (or a central meeting point) and gently introduces you to the historic heart of Istanbul: Sultanahmet.
Depending on opening hours and prayer times, your private guided Old City tour may include:
Hagia Sophia Mosque
Step into one of the world’s most famous buildings. Once a church, later a mosque, then a museum, and now again a mosque, Hagia Sophia tells the story of Istanbul itself. Your guide shares its history in clear, engaging language—no dry lectures.Blue Mosque (Sultanahmet Mosque)
Admire the elegant domes and blue Iznik tiles. Your guide will explain mosque etiquette and local customs so you can visit respectfully and confidently.Hippodrome Square
Walk where Roman and Byzantine crowds once cheered chariot races. See the Egyptian Obelisk, Serpentine Column, and German Fountain and learn how this square shaped Istanbul’s history.
You move at a comfortable, unhurried pace, with plenty of time for photos and breaks.

Morning: Turkish Breakfast & Tasting Walk
Start your day like a local with a gentle Turkish breakfast, which typically includes:
Fresh bread and simit (sesame ring bread)
Local cheeses and olives
Tomatoes, cucumbers, eggs
Jams, honey, and sometimes clotted cream
Unlimited Turkish tea
